pub fn and(p1: fn(a) -> Bool, p2: fn(a) -> Bool) -> fn(a) -> Bool

Combines two predicates with logical AND. Returns True only if both predicates return True.

Examples

let is_even = fn(x) { x % 2 == 0 }
let is_positive = fn(x) { x > 0 }
let is_even_and_positive = and(is_even, is_positive)
is_even_and_positive(4) // True
is_even_and_positive(3) // False
is_even_and_positive(-2) // False
pub fn not(p: fn(a) -> Bool) -> fn(a) -> Bool

Negates a predicate function.

Examples

let is_even = fn(x) { x % 2 == 0 }
let is_odd = not(is_even)
is_odd(3) // True
is_odd(4) // False
pub fn or(p1: fn(a) -> Bool, p2: fn(a) -> Bool) -> fn(a) -> Bool

Combines two predicates with logical OR. Returns True if either predicate returns True.

Examples

let is_even = fn(x) { x % 2 == 0 }
let is_positive = fn(x) { x > 0 }
let is_even_or_positive = or(is_even, is_positive)
is_even_or_positive(3) // True (positive)
is_even_or_positive(4) // True (both)
is_even_or_positive(-1) // False (neither)
